'Betty White's 90th Birthday: A Tribute to America's Golden Girl' to Air 1/16
by Kelsey Denette
- Dec 20, 2011
Some of Hollywood's biggest stars -- including Mary Tyler Moore, Hugh Jackman, Jay Leno, Amy Poehler and Carol Burnett -- will celebrate the birthday of one of the world's most beloved entertainers in 'Betty White's 90th Birthday: A Tribute to America's Golden Girl' on Monday, January 16 (8-9:30 p.m. ET) on NBC. White's 'Hot in Cleveland' co-stars Valerie Bertinelli, Wendy Mallick and Jane Leeves, along with her 'Mary Tyler Moore' co-stars Ed Asner, Valerie Harper and Gavin MacLeod, will also be on hand to deliver birthday wishes, as will Joel McHale, William Shatner and many more. Immediately following the birthday special will be a sneak preview of the outrageously funny hidden-camera series 'Betty White's Off Their Rockers,' airing from 9:30-10 p.m. ET.

BWW Polls: Do You Think It's Time to Bring Back the Tony Awards Category for 'Best Special Theatrical Event?'
by BWW
- Dec 16, 2011
After CONTACT (a show that featured all pre-recorded music) controversially took home the 2000 Tony Award for Best Musical, the 'Best Special Theatrical Event' category was created to include shows that fit neither the description of a play nor a musical. After Broadway legend Liza Minnelli won the Special Event Tony in 2009, the category was officially retired, allowing shows that qualified to be nominated in other categories.
William Shatner Headed to Broadway in One-Man Show
by Robert Diamond
- Dec 16, 2011
Michael Riedel reports in today's New York Post that William Shatner is headed to Broadway in early 2012 with a 2-3 week engagement of SHATNER'S WORD: WE JUST LIVE IN IT which will play for 2-3 weeks at the Music Box Theater on Broadway. The show will be a temporary booking at the theatre, which is currently home to PRIVATE LIVES, which just moved up its closing to December 31.
